Here you will find the Biographies and History conferences that we held in collaboration with Carmen Iglesias, the Royal Academy of History and the Cultural Foundation of the Spanish Nobility.

In the 2024 cycle, “the arrival of Modernity” was studied through a series of conferences focused on the figure of Cardinal Cisneros, in his roles as cardinal and archbishop of Toledo, inquisitor general, patron and political regent. Through their eyes we will witness the significant changes that took place in Spain at the end of the 15th century and the beginning of the 16th century.
